> And it's interesting - PGA3 can't connect without defining the root
crt... Why???

The root ca certificate is required to verify that the client is trusted by
the ca, and therefore by the server. It is also required to verify that the
server is trusted, so you know you are connecting to your server rather
than an impostor put up by hackers with a man-in-the-middle attack, dns
poisoning, etc.

> Yesterday I installed PGA4, but I didn't find any option for
certificates... Hmmm...

The client certificate authentication mechanism has not yet been developped
for pgAdmin4. The feature has been requested, but I don't know if anyone
has started working on it. I look forward to the addition of authentication
options in pgAdmin4.
